lard

noun

The white solid or semisolid rendered fat of a hog.

transitive verb

To cover or coat with lard or a similar fat.

transitive verb

To insert strips of fat or bacon in (meat) before cooking.

transitive verb

To enrich or lace heavily with extra material; embellish.

transitive verb

To fill throughout; inject.

noun

The fat of swine; bacon; pork.

noun

The fat of swine after being separated from the flesh and membranes by the process of rendering; the clarified semi-solid oil of hogs’ fat.

To stuff with bacon or pork; introduce thin pieces of salt pork, ham, or bacon into the substance of (a joint of meat) before cooking, in order to improve its flavor.

Hence To intersperse with something by way of improvement or ornamentation; enrich; garnish; interlard.
